IVE’s Jang Wonyoung Fights Back Tears at Awards Ceremony, Facing Hateful Comments

IVE’s Wonyoung fought back tears at the 2025 K-World Dream Awards after winning the Solo Artist Popularity Award, facing both hateful comments and strong fan support.

At the 2025 K-World Dream Awards held on August 21, IVE’s Jang Wonyoung experienced a bittersweet moment that stirred emotions among both fans and netizens. The idol, who won the Solo Artist Popularity Award, appeared visibly emotional as she tried to hold back tears while receiving the honor. Fans were quick to rally around her, sharing online that they hoped Wonyoung could truly feel the support and love they had for her, stressing that she more than deserved the recognition.

Unfortunately, her victory also sparked a wave of negativity. Some detractors claimed she did not deserve the award or accused her agency of “buying” it. However, many netizens immediately defended Wonyoung, emphasizing that her popularity is undeniable and that the award reflected her genuine impact in the K-pop industry.

The contrast between Wonyoung’s moving reaction and the backlash highlighted the challenges idols often face, where even achievements can become targets for hate. Still, the overwhelming defense from fans served as a reminder of her strong influence and the loyal community that continues to stand firmly behind her.
